[1][2] The Lagoon 40 is a recreational catamaran, built predominantly of vacuum infused polyester fiberglass, with wood trim.

The hulls have plumb stems, reverse transoms with swimming platforms, dual internally mounted spade-type rudders controlled by a wheel and twin fixed fin keels.

The galley is L-shaped and is equipped with a four-burner stove, a refrigerator, freezer and a double sink.
